Embark on a journey into the world of vegetable gardening and discover the joy of cultivating your own fresh produce. Starting a patch is easier than you think, and with a little expertise, you can be enjoying delicious, homegrown greens in no time.
First, select a sunny area for your garden that receives at least six hours of exposure per day. Prepare the soil by adding nutrients to enrich it and improve drainage.
Next, decide on the plants you'd like to grow. Consider your weather and personal tastes. Start with easy-to-grow varieties like lettuce for a successful first crop.
Read the planting instructions on seed packets or plant tags to ensure proper spacing and depth. Moisturize your garden regularly, keeping the soil consistently moist. And don't forget to weed any unwanted plants that may compete with your garden bounty.
As your crops grow, be sure to observe them for any signs of pests or diseases. With a little care and attention, you'll soon be enjoying the fruits (or greens!) of your labor!
